怎么用node.js搭建一个web服务器_使用Node.js搭建Web服务器

2024-04-11 136

怎么用node.js搭建一个web服务器_使用Node.js搭建Web服务器

Image

Node.js是一种基于Chrome V8引擎的JavaScript运行环境,它可以使JavaScript在服务器端运行,因此它也被称为服务器端JavaScript。Node.js的出现使得前端开发者可以在服务器端使用JavaScript来开发Web应用程序。我们将介绍如何使用Node.js搭建Web服务器。

我们需要安装Node.js。你可以在Node.js官网上下载的Node.js安装包,并按照安装向导进行安装。安装完成后,你可以在命令行中输入node -v来检查Node.js是否已经成功安装。

接下来,我们需要创建一个文件夹来存放我们的Web服务器代码。在命令行中,进入你想要创建文件夹的目录,然后输入mkdir mywebserver来创建一个名为mywebserver的文件夹。接着,进入mywebserver文件夹,使用命令行输入npm init来初始化一个新的Node.js项目。在初始化过程中,你需要输入一些项目信息,例如项目名称、版本号、作者等等。

初始化完成后,我们需要安装一个名为express的Node.js模块,它可以帮助我们更轻松地搭建Web服务器。在命令行中,输入npm install express --save来安装express模块,并将其保存到我们的项目依赖中。

现在,我们已经准备好开始编写我们的Web服务器代码了。在mywebserver文件夹中,创建一个名为server.js的文件,并在其中输入以下代码:

```javascript

const express = require('express');

const app = express();

app.get('/', (req, res) => {

res.send('Hello World!');

});

app.listen(3000, () => {

console.log('Web server is running on port 3000');

});

```

以上代码创建了一个基本的Web服务器,它监听3000端口,并在浏览器中访问 World!”的响应。这里我们使用了express的get方法来处理HTTP GET请求,并使用res.send方法来发送响应。

我们可以在命令行中输入node server.js来启动我们的Web服务器。如果一切顺利,你应该能够在浏览器中访问 World!”的响应。

总结一下,使用Node.js搭建Web服务器非常简单。我们只需要安装Node.js和express模块,然后编写一些简单的代码就可以创建一个基本的Web服务器。通过使用Node.js,我们可以在服务器端使用JavaScript来开发Web应用程序,这为前端开发者带来了更多的机会和挑战。

// 来源:https://www.nzw6.com

1. 本站所有资源来源于用户上传和网络,因此不包含技术服务请大家谅解!如有侵权请邮件联系客服!cheeksyu@vip.qq.com
2. 本站不保证所提供下载的资源的准确性、安全性和完整性,资源仅供下载学习之用!如有链接无法下载、失效或广告,请联系客服处理!
3. 您必须在下载后的24个小时之内,从您的电脑中彻底删除上述内容资源!如用于商业或者非法用途,与本站无关,一切后果请用户自负!
4. 如果您也有好的资源或教程,您可以投稿发布,成功分享后有积分奖励和额外收入!
5.严禁将资源用于任何违法犯罪行为,不得违反国家法律,否则责任自负,一切法律责任与本站无关

发表评论
暂无评论